    Next we had to decide how to sell. A few homes in our neighborhood had recently sold, but they were never on the MLS. Turns out they were Ibuyers, the one most used was Offer pad but there are other companies too like Express offer, and Redfin. Offerpad was definitely appealing you can choose your move out date at your convenience, never have a showing, and not have to do any repairs or cleaning! The part I liked most was if you couldn’t find a home you could rent your home back for a small fee until you found something.

    So why didn’t we go with the Offerpad offer? Well it was below what we could get if we used a traditional realtor, so much below that I could buy a brand new car with the difference.
